May 12, 2018
The Liberty just called in with 1 Bluefin Tuna at 140lbs. They also caught 2 more at 60lbs each. They are seeing good sign of fish. The captain recomends bringing your 25lb set up and 40lb to 80lb set ups. Flatfall jigs are recomended. 

The Condor just called in at  with 5 Bluefin tuna at 50-70lbs & 18 Yellowtail.

The Dolphin AM trip finished with 65 Mackerel, 15 Rockfish, 1 Halibut, 1 Lingcod,and 1 Calibo Bass (20 released) for 31 anglers. 

The Pacific Queen has 18 Bluefin on board in the 40-60lb range and one of which weighs in at 181lb and still fishing!

The Shogun returned this morning from their 3 day trip with 14 Bluefin tuna, 11 Yellowtail and 2 Bonito.
